Biography

Senator Brad Starnes is a dedicated public servant representing District 22 in the Kansas State Senate. He assumed office on January 13, 2025, after winning the general election on November 5, 2024. His current term is set to end on January 8, 2029. Brad Starnes is a member of the Republican Party and has a strong commitment to serving his constituents and addressing their needs.

Brad Starnes earned his bachelor’s degree from Sterling College and later pursued a graduate degree from West Texas A&M University. His career experience includes working as a teacher, coach, and superintendent, which has provided him with a deep understanding of the education system and the challenges faced by students and educators.

In the Kansas State Senate, Senator Starnes serves on several important committees, including the Education Committee, the Senate Select Committee on Veterans Affairs, the Assessment and Taxation Committee, the Agriculture and Natural Resources Committee, and the Federal and State Affairs Committee. His involvement in these committees allows him to contribute to a wide range of legislative issues and advocate for policies that benefit his constituents.

Senator Starnes has sponsored several bills and resolutions during his tenure. Some of the notable bills he has sponsored include SB10, which provides property tax exemptions for certain personal property, and SB118, which imposes conditional term limits on members of the legislature. He has also sponsored SB200, designating Kansas as a Purple Heart State and requiring the governor to proclaim August 7 of each year as Purple Heart Day. Additionally, he has sponsored resolutions such as SCR1603, which proposes to amend the Kansas Constitution to limit property tax valuation increases, and SCR1610, which recognizes the right to bear arms as a fundamental right.
